Q: Is 606,718 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 606,718 is a composite number.

Why is 606,718 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 606,718 can be evenly divided by 1 2 7 14 41 49 82 98 151 287 302 574 1,057 2,009 2,114 4,018 6,191 7,399 12,382 14,798 43,337 86,674 303,359 and 606,718, with no remainder.

Since 606,718 cannot be divided by just 1 and 606,718, it is a composite number.
